Job description

Company Introduction

We partner and innovate with our customers to provide the highest quality, life enhancing medical devices in the world.

Work Schedule

8:00AM-4:30PM

Responsibilities
  • Manage daily workload under minimal supervision to meet expect personal/department goals.
  • Maintain organized workspace and perform line clearance activities consistently.
  • Visual inspection of parts.
  • Communicate with co-workers respectfully and professionally.
  • Complete required documentation and inspection operations with detail, accuracy, and precision.
  • Maintain the focus needed to complete tasks in a timely, efficient, and accurate manor.
  • May help train new employees as required
  • Simple visual and measurement inspections (in-process, incoming, final)
  • DHR Reviews.
  • Perform basic ERP transactions.
  • Create and approve Certs of Compliance.
  • Read and follow quality work instructions.
  • Performs other related duties as assigned.
Requirements
  • High School diploma or equivalent. Associate’s Degree in a technical field or other technical degree preferred
Experience
  • 2 years of experience in manufacturing inspection environment preferred
Skills/Competencies
  • Basic understanding of blue print reading, inspection equipment and sampling plans.
  • Basic machine shop math (i.e. fractions to decimals and metric conversion).
  • Basic understanding of problem solving and specification requirements in relationship to the gage used and the part tolerance.

Physical Requirements
  • Light physical activity performing non-strenuous day-to-day activities of an administrative nature.
  • Minimal lifting (20 lbs.), carrying (10 lbs.), bending, pushing/pulling, crawling, climbing, balancing, and prolonged standing.
  • Manual dexterity sufficient to reach and handle items.
  • Requires the ability to identify and distinguish colors, judge distance and space relationships (i.e. visualize objects of multiple dimensions), and adjust the lens of the eye to bring an object into sharp focus (microscope, etc.).

Viant is a global medical device design and manufacturing services provider that partners and innovates with customers to provide the highest quality, life enhancing medical devices. We do this through our depth and breadth of capabilities, end-to-end integration, technical expertise, and relentless focus on our customers and on operational excellence. With nearly 6,000 associates across 24 locations worldwide, we offer a unique combination of small-company service and attention with big-company resources.
